Factors to Consider When Buying a Water Slide

Before purchasing a water slide, consider the following factors:

  • Space Availability: Assess your yard's size to determine how large of a water slide you can accommodate. Some models require more space for safe operation.
  • Age Range: Choose a slide that is appropriate for the ages of all potential users. Some slides are designed specifically for younger children, while others can handle adults.
  • Durability: Look for slides made from high-quality materials that can withstand wear and tear, ensuring they last for multiple seasons.
  • Ease of Setup: Some inflatable slides can be inflated quickly and easily, while others might take longer or require additional equipment.
  • Safety Features: Ensure the slide has adequate safety measures, such as reinforced seams, safety nets, and proper weight limits.

Inflatable vs. Permanent Water Slides: What’s Best for You?

When choosing between inflatable and permanent water slides, consider your long-term needs and space constraints. Inflatable slides are portable and can be deflated and stored when not in use, making them suitable for those with limited yard space. However, permanent slides offer durability and readiness for spontaneous fun but require more significant investment and yard commitment. Weigh the pros and cons of each option to find the ideal solution for your family.

Step-by-Step Guide to Easy Installation

To set up your inflatable water slide, follow these steps:

  1. Choose a Suitable Location: Pick a flat area clear of sharp objects, debris, or rocks to prevent damage.
  2. Unpack and Layout: Remove the slide from the packaging and lay it out flat on the ground.
  3. Inflate: Use an air blower to inflate the slide, ensuring all corners are filled properly.
  4. Secure it: Stake the slide to the ground if required, to prevent it from moving during use.
  5. Fill with Water: Use a hose to fill the slide, ensuring that the water levels are appropriate for safe sliding.

Maintenance Tips for Longevity and Safety

Maintaining your water slide is crucial for safety and durability. Here are some tips:

  • Clean Regularly: Rinse the slide with clean water after each use to remove dirt and debris.
  • Check for Damage: Inspect the slide for any punctures or tears before and after use. Use a repair kit for minor damages.
  • Proper Storage: Ensure the slide is completely dry before folding and storing to prevent mold and mildew.

Common Challenges and How to Overcome Them

While inflatable water slides are generally easy to use, some common challenges include air leakage, insufficient water flow, or instability. To address these:

  • Inspect the air blower regularly for signs of malfunction.
  • Ensure proper water flow by checking hose connections.
  • Secure the slide adequately to prevent shifting during use.

Safety Guidelines for Enjoying Water Slides

While water slides are undeniably fun, safety should always be a priority. Here are some key safety guidelines:

  • Supervise children at all times while using the slide.
  • Ensure users are following the weight limits and size restrictions of the slide.
  • Utilize safety gear such as helmets or floating devices if necessary.
  • Keep the area around the slide clear of obstacles.

Are inflatable water slides safe for kids?

Yes, inflatable water slides are generally safe for children when used following the manufacturer's guidelines, with adult supervision present at all times.

What is the best age to use a water slide?

While age appropriateness can vary by slide model, many inflatable water slides are designed for children ages 3 and up, with specific slides catering to older kids and adults.

How do I properly store my water slide after use?

Ensure your slide is completely dry before folding it. Store it in a cool, dry place to prevent mildew and damage.

Can adults use inflatable water slides?

Yes, many inflatable water slides can accommodate adults, but it’s crucial to check the weight limit specified by the manufacturer.

What materials are water slides typically made from?

Water slides are commonly made from heavy-duty vinyl or PVC materials, designed to withstand punctures and ensure long-lasting use.
